Output de0d0196f1012c423ea93afa7067698005e760bc9391ea0359cf24d009711659:0

value
44900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ad63f83ca1aa2ff23289363b194a30c4ddaaa85b OP_EQUAL
address
3HVpakBAk6PyaXmYYjWctRdms9RxowBGGa
transaction
de0d0196f1012c423ea93afa7067698005e760bc9391ea0359cf24d009711659
confirmations
191576
spent
true